Job Responsibilities/Key accountabilities: * Quality checking digital packaging artwork against supplied information. * Utilising the AMS (Artwork Management System) and digital tools to effectively complete quality checks. * Liaising with other team members including artwork and admin to ensure excellent communication and efficient ways of working. * Accurately reporting quality errors and working as part of a team to reduce future errors. * Attending and contributing to team and quality meetings * Be the QC lead for a specified customer, supporting the Artwork client lead in managing guidelines and queries internally * Provide and support QC and customer specific training within the department * General administrative tasks Knowledge, Skills, Experience * Quality Checking/Proof Checking experience gained in a fast paced, design or print pre-press production background * Experience of quality checking (including copy checking) packaging artwork ideally within the pharmaceutical industry. * Good standard of English. * PC literate. * Knowledge of Litho and Flexo printing pre-press specifications would be advantageous * Experience of online checking tools and text verification systems. * Knowledge of Esko checking tools would be advantageous. * Experience of Adobe CC and artwork skills would be advantageous.
